titleOfInvention Process for producing heat-generating counter-measures and a pack containing heat-generating counter-measures
abstract The invention relates to a process for producing heat-generating counter-measures which are intended to be dispensed from sea-based, land-based or air based systems, with heat being generated when an iron compound reacts with oxygen thereby forming iron oxide. The invention also relates to a pack (1) containing heat-generating counter-measures (8) which pack comprises a container (2) and a lid (3), accommodates heat-generating counter-measures and is intended to be dispensed from sea-based, land-based or air-based systems, with heat being generated when the pack (1) is opened, during the dispensing, such that the content of the pack in the form of an iron compound makes contact, and is allowed to react, with oxygen thereby forming iron oxide and heat. According to the invention, the iron compound which is to react with oxygen consists of iron sulphide. The invention provides a less complicated process for producing heat-generating counter-measures, which process does not require the use of vacuum chambers or special spaces containing a protective atmosphere and which, at the same time, makes it possible to produce reliable packs which have an effective action.
